A 2019 ruling by the 10th Circuit Court of Appeals has some activist women gearing up to go topless in public in several midwestern states. Some say the ruling could apply to Oklahoma, Colorado, Kansas, New Mexico, Utah, and Wyoming. But it's not clear if these activists will be able to legally get away with their plans without being arrested.
